I have a 35' travel trailer that I usually take down to Florida for the winter. We decided to spend the Holidays here in Ohio this winter and was wondering if anyone knew the procedure to winterize a travel trailer. I have purchased 3 gallons of the RV winterizer, how much does the job usually take? I appreciate the info.

All depends. Does your trailer have the hot water bypass? If so, drain your water storage tank and water heater. Put 2 gallons in your water tank, and use your 12v pump to run glycol to your faucets and toilet. Using the bypass, you don't have to fill your water heater to get it out your hot water faucets. If you don't have a bypass, you'll probably need to put 6 or 7 gallons in. Make sure to hit all your drains too. And be sure to get some through your toilet valve. They are fragile and a little moisture will crack them. If you don't have a bypass, it can be done with less if you have an air compressor, air hose adapter and a hand pump, but if you haven't done it before, this is the safest way.

Tom covered the topic very well; just be sure you actually drain the water heater. I've seen some who opened the drain valve, thought they had it drained, but did not open the relief valve at the top to let air in and did not get all the water out. And being in the RV repair business, my two brothers have replaced lots of water heaters that burst from freezing.
